Self-oscillating resonant AC/DC converter topology for inputpower-factor correction

Summary:This paper presents the analysis and design of a single-phase
single-stage high-power-factor AC/DC converter employing a
series-parallel resonant topology operating in self-sustained
oscillating mode. A control approach is proposed to achieve low total
harmonic distortion of the input current. This approach does not require
sensing of the input current. In addition, the inverter output current
is limited during transients, and the converter operates with zero
voltage switching for all operating conditions including open and short
circuit. The performance of the proposed scheme is verified
experimentally on a 500 W prototype
